g91编程时xy是什么坐标系

fiy 其他 138

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    G91编程时,XY是相对坐标系。

    在CNC编程中,G91是一种坐标系命令,用于指定坐标系的工作方式。G91指令表示将坐标系切换为相对坐标系。

    相对坐标系是相对于当前位置的坐标系。当G91指令被激活时,机床会将当前位置视为原点,然后根据编程指令中给出的坐标值进行移动。例如,如果当前位置是X=50,Y=50,当编程指令为X+10时,机床会将刀具从当前位置沿X轴正方向移动10个单位,而不是绝对坐标系中的X=10。

    在相对坐标系中,XY坐标表示在X轴和Y轴上的相对位移。因此,如果编程指令为X+10,Y-5,机床会将刀具从当前位置沿X轴正方向移动10个单位,并沿Y轴负方向移动5个单位。

    相对坐标系的优点是可以更方便地进行复杂路径的编程。通过使用相对坐标系,可以根据当前位置进行相对移动,从而减少绝对坐标系中的计算量。

    总之,G91编程时,XY是相对坐标系,表示在X轴和Y轴上的相对位移。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在G91编程中,XY是相对坐标系。

    G91是G代码中的一种模式,用于设置坐标系。在G91模式下,所有的指令都是相对于当前位置的增量指令。这意味着每个指令的值将被添加到当前位置的值上,而不是从绝对零点开始计算。

    XY是指机床的工作平面上的两个轴,X轴和Y轴。X轴通常表示水平方向,Y轴通常表示垂直方向。在G91编程中,XY坐标表示相对于当前位置的增量值。

    具体来说,如果在G91模式下,设置X轴的增量为10,Y轴的增量为20,那么机床将按照当前位置的X轴值加上10,Y轴值加上20的方式进行运动。这样可以方便地实现相对运动,例如在加工过程中进行平移、相对定位等操作。

    总结起来,XY在G91编程中表示相对坐标系,用于指定机床工作平面上的X轴和Y轴的增量值。通过使用相对坐标系,可以方便地实现相对运动和定位操作。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在G91编程模式下,XY坐标系是相对坐标系。相对坐标系是以当前位置为参考点,通过指定相对于当前位置的增量值来确定下一个位置的坐标。

    在G代码中,使用G91指令可以将机床切换到相对坐标模式。在相对坐标模式下,所有的运动指令(如G00、G01、G02等)都是基于当前位置进行计算的。

    下面是使用G91编程时XY坐标系的操作流程:

    1. 使用G90指令将机床切换到绝对坐标模式,以确保起始位置的准确性。

    2. 使用G91指令将机床切换到相对坐标模式。

    3. 使用G00、G01、G02等指令指定XY轴的运动路径和距离。

    • G00:快速移动,不考虑加工精度,直接到达目标位置。
    • G01:线性插补,按照指定的速度和加工路径匀速移动到目标位置。
    • G02:圆弧插补,按照指定的半径和方向绘制圆弧。
    1. 在每个运动指令中,使用X和Y参数指定相对于当前位置的增量值。例如,X10 Y20表示在X轴上向正方向移动10个单位,在Y轴上向正方向移动20个单位。

    2. 在完成所有运动指令后,使用M30指令结束程序。

    需要注意的是,在使用相对坐标系时,程序中的每个运动指令都会相对于上一个指令的位置进行计算,而不是相对于起始位置。因此,如果需要从绝对坐标系切换到相对坐标系,需要确保所有的运动指令都是相对于当前位置的增量值。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部